Samsung Galaxy Buds Plus

The one that we discovered to hit the ideal combination between battery life, noise cancellation, and comfort without being overly pricey is the Samsung Galaxy Buds Plus. The Samsung Galaxy Buds Plus has one of the best Traveling Earbuds and longest battery lives on this list, with a playback length of 11 hours, despite the fact that there are newer Samsung earbuds available like the Samsung Galaxy Buds 2. We hardly ever need to charge the earbud during the day and frequently use it extensively every day as we commute while listening to music on our phone and laptop. The earbud case also contains one more charge, giving you a total of roughly 20 hours. The Samsung Galaxy Buds Plus lasted me more than 22 hours of playback time on a single charge, 11 hours each earbud as we rotated between them. We frequently go on multi-day excursions while wearing one Samsung Galaxy Buds Plus earbud without using the case.

Sennheiser MOMENTUM True Wireless 3 Earbuds

The best Traveling Earbuds we’ve tested are the Sennheiser MOMENTUM True Wireless 3. These well-built buds outperform some over-ears at this price point, such as the Razer Barracuda Pro Wireless, if you prefer a lighter, more portable option to over-ears. Their ANC system is quite effective at reducing ambient noise, such as the low rumbling of bus and Aeroplane engines and passenger chatter. They have a continuous battery life of more than eight hours with their ANC activated, and their carrying bag has three extra charges. Although they feature a deep in-ear fit and their stability fins can exert pressure on your outer ear, they are reasonably comfortable to wear. Their bass-heavy sound is perfect for hip-hop and EDM, two genres that can use a little additional boom and warmth. Their companion app offers a graphic EQ and presets if you’d like have a different sound.

Edifier NeoBuds Pro Earbuds

Easily one of the best Traveling Earbuds available on the market, The NeoBuds Pro from Edifier are the best noise-canceling earbuds we’ve tried for less than $150, making them a perfect option for travelers looking to save some cash. With three microphones, the NeoBuds Pro provide exceptional noise cancellation and crystal-clear audio during video chats. These earbuds provided great noise cancellation in our tests. If you listen to music at about 70% volume, you should expect to totally eradicate the sound of an airplane’s engine. According to Edifier, the Neobuds Pro have a five-hour battery life with active noise cancellation switched on and a six-hour battery life off. Depending on your settings, their battery case extends the battery life by 15 to 18 hours. Although the EQ on the NeoBuds Pro may be customized using Edifier’s Connect app, we loved how they sounded right out of the box. The difference between the clarity of the music and certain high-end earbuds is little. Overall, Edifier’s ability to produce a terrific all-around pair of noise-canceling earbuds without skimping leaves us impressed.

Apple AirPods Pro

We were astonished by how effective the AirPods Pro’s active noise cancellation was when Apple first introduced them. Despite their small size, they provide excellent passive noise cancellation thanks to a snug fit, and when the active noise cancellation is activated, they produce almost complete silence. The AirPods’ touch controls are simple to use, and depending on how you use them, they can automatically transition between your iPhone, iPad, and Mac if you’re a fully subscribed member of the Apple ecosystem. The earbuds’ battery life is 4.5 hours, but they may be used for an additional 24 hours of playback by periodically placing them in the charging case.

Sony WF-1000XM4 Earbuds

The Sony WF-1000XM4 earbuds are the best Traveling Earbuds money can currently buy if you have no restrictions on spending and are seeking for the absolute best earbuds that are small and light, have the best noise cancellation in the business, and have the best sound quality from such a little device. The Sony WF-1000XM4 earbuds offer the best noise cancellation available, turning a raucous bus into a quiet, tranquil environment. No other earbuds can accomplish this. Not to mention the device’s superb battery life, which allows for continuous playback for more than 8 hours even with ANC enabled. These earbuds are the longest-lasting on this list with ANC off, lasting more than 12 hours. For a total of 24 hours of playback with ANC and 36 hours without ANC, you may charge the earbuds twice with the case. With all these first-rate capabilities, you should also expect to pay a first-rate price for them, with the earbuds retailing for 278 USD.

Jabra Elite 65T True Wireless Earbuds

The earbuds from Jabra are wonderfully cozy and secure without awkwardly dangling off your ear like AirPods. Many headphones cut corners with the microphone, but Jabra’s four-mic technology produces outstanding sound while reducing wind noise, making them ideal for calls. This kind is made exclusively for mobile devices, so they’ll work great if your employer calls you while you’re away. These earbuds are an economical alternative, especially given that they’re presently selling for less than a third of what they initially cost, even though you have to give up battery life (only 1.5 hours) and noise cancellation.

Klipsch T5 II ANC

Our best Traveling Earbuds who desire a first-class experience on every flight is Klispch’s T5 II ANC earbuds. They have amazing audio quality and a better battery case than Apple’s AirPods. The T5 II ANCs surprised us with their depth in our tests when listening to music of all genres. Although Klipsch gives you the opportunity to do so through its Connect app, we never changed the earphones’ EQ. The T5 II ANCs’ six sets of included ear tips will be appreciated by frequent travelers, and they stayed in our ears better than any earphones with gummy tips. It was much simpler to completely appreciate the music when I had confidence that these earbuds wouldn’t come out. The T5 II ANCs from Klipsch were exceptional at noise cancelling. When music was played at roughly half volume, we were able to shut out the majority of background noise. If you’re on a plane, 60% of the volume should be sufficient to drown out the sound of the engine. The T5 II ANCs, according to Klipsch, have a five-hour noise cancelling runtime and a seven-hour runtime without it. In our experiments, we managed a little bit more than that. The battery cover for the T5 II ANCs extends playback time by 15 to 21 hours. With the Kipsch T5 II ANCs, you can concentrate on your music and forthcoming trip rather than distracting outside noise.
